Iran captain Taremi slams FIFA for ‘catastrophe’ World Cup as nation waits on qualification
Iran captain Mehdi Taremi has criticised FIFA and described points of the World Cup as a “catastrophe” after his facet’s hopes of reaching the knockout stage have been left hanging within the stability.
Iran have been denied a dramatic late winner of their closing Group G match towards Egypt on Friday, with Shojae Khalilzadeh’s stoppage-time effort dominated out for offside following a VAR assessment.
The goalless draw leaves Iran ready to find whether or not they are going to progress as one of many event’s greatest third-placed groups. They presently sit sixth in that rating, with the highest eight advancing to the final 32.
Iran additionally struck the crossbar late on as they pushed for a decisive purpose, however Egypt held on to safe second place and a knockout tie towards Australia.
Taremi fumes at FIFA
Talking after the match in Seattle, Taremi expressed frustration over the journey preparations imposed on the Iranian squad all through the event.
Attributable to visa restrictions, Iran have been primarily based within the Mexican metropolis of Tijuana and have been required to journey again there after matches performed in the USA.
“We’ve to beg. We’ve spoken about these points for the reason that starting,” Taremi mentioned.
“It’s a catastrophe. These issues ought to have been solved earlier than the event began.
“Mr Infantino got here into our dressing room earlier than the primary recreation and informed us it was solely the start, however the group stage is already completed and nothing has modified.
“We don’t have all of our employees right here as a result of a few of them couldn’t get visas. We hold travelling again to Tijuana after matches. We love the folks there they usually’ve been very welcoming, however that is speculated to be knowledgeable competitors.
“After a recreation like this, we needs to be recovering. As an alternative, we’re travelling once more. In our opinion, that’s not truthful.”
‘Infantino can do extra to assist’
Taremi additionally referred to as on FIFA president Gianni Infantino to do extra to assist Iran in the event that they qualify for the knockout rounds.
Iran are provisionally set to face Switzerland in Vancouver ought to they advance.
“We at all times give all the pieces for our folks,” Taremi added.
“We wish to make them blissful and ship a message of peace to everybody in Iran and world wide.
“However there isn’t a peace for us on this scenario. Somebody has to resolve these issues. Whether or not it’s FIFA or another person, I don’t know.
“I consider Infantino can do extra to assist.”
In the meantime, Egypt secured second place in Group G and can face Australia within the final 32.
Group winners Belgium booked their place within the knockout stage after a 5-1 win over New Zealand and are presently set to fulfill South Korea within the subsequent spherical.
